Short Ayurveda Treatments for Travelers
Many travelers imagine Ayurveda as a long program lasting one or two weeks. That type of retreat is valuable for people who want deeper guidance, but Bentota is also suitable for shorter experiences. A visitor may choose a one-hour massage, a two-hour relaxation package, a short herbal therapy session, a head and shoulder treatment, a foot massage or a half-day wellness plan. These short treatments are ideal for tourists who want to taste Sri Lankan Ayurveda without committing to a full residential program.
A good Ayurveda center usually begins by asking about comfort, health concerns and personal preferences. Some places have an Ayurvedic doctor or wellness consultant, especially for more serious programs. For simple relaxation treatments, trained therapists may guide the guest through oil massage, steam, herbal compresses or other gentle therapies. Visitors with medical conditions, pregnancy, allergies, high blood pressure or recent surgery should always speak openly before treatment and avoid anything unsuitable.
Herbal Therapies and Traditional Oils
Herbal oils are central to many Ayurveda treatments. In Sri Lankan wellness centers, oils may be prepared with local herbs and used for massage, scalp treatments, joint comfort or relaxation. The fragrance of these oils is part of the experience. It may be earthy, warm, sweet or medicinal, depending on the ingredients. When used by a skilled therapist, warm oil massage can help the body feel relaxed and nourished after travel fatigue.
Some centers also offer herbal steam, herbal baths, body wraps, flower baths or gentle cleansing-style wellness packages. These should be understood as traditional wellness experiences, not as guaranteed medical cures. The value for many travelers is in rest, touch, warmth, fragrance and the feeling of being cared for. Massage Experiences in Bentota
Massage is one of the most popular Ayurveda-related experiences in Bentota. A full-body oil massage, often inspired by Abhyanga, is a common choice. Head massage, foot massage, face massage and back massage are also widely offered. These treatments can be especially pleasant after long flights, long drives, beach activities or sightseeing days in the southern and western coastal regions.
The best massage experience depends on communication. Guests should tell the therapist if pressure is too strong, if any area should be avoided or if they prefer a gentle treatment. A professional Ayurveda center should make the guest feel safe, comfortable and respected. Clean rooms, fresh linens, clear timing, polite staff and transparent pricing are all important signs of a good wellness experience.

Ayurveda Resorts and Wellness Centers
Bentota has a range of wellness options. Some are small local Ayurveda centers offering short treatments and massage. Others are connected to hotels, resorts and villas, where guests can enjoy spa menus, doctor consultations, yoga, meditation, Ayurveda cuisine or multi-day programs. Places in and around Bentota often combine Sri Lankan Ayurveda with tropical resort comfort.
For travelers seeking a more structured experience, an Ayurveda resort may offer an initial consultation and a personalized program. This can include daily treatments, diet guidance, yoga or meditation. For travelers who only want relaxation, a shorter treatment at a trusted center may be enough. The important thing is to choose the right level of experience for your time, health and comfort.

How to Choose a Good Center
When choosing an Ayurveda center in Bentota, visitors should look for cleanliness, trained staff, clear treatment descriptions and honest communication. If a center offers medical-style programs, it is better when a qualified Ayurvedic doctor or experienced practitioner is involved. Guests should ask about oils, treatment duration, price, aftercare and whether the treatment is suitable for their health condition.
Travelers should be careful with places that promise instant cures or pressure guests into expensive packages. Ayurveda can be a beautiful wellness tradition, but it should be practiced with respect and care. A good center will explain options calmly, listen to the guest and create a comfortable environment.
